Is there any way to exclude the cell from the range? Here is the deal, this is how my sheet looks now (grey cells doesn't contain a formula)

43654562191026982215.png

R Ye8FAowygUQbQKAOJGjlqQs5mQM48WC6X9P8DLQFKUC8BRoQAAAAASUVORK5CYII=


I2:I11 - people that need to be connected to the task (there are 6 tasks - M3:M8 ; H15:H20)
J2 - there is RAND() formula
N3:N8 there is =INDEX(I$3:I$11;MATCH(LARGE(J$3:J$11;M3);J$3:J$11;0);0) - so it is giving me randomly one person per task (without reps)

But the thing is: if person 8 was attached to the task number 1 - he can't be attached to the same task in the next week. That is why i have created A2:G11. For example cell B3 contains: =IF(A3=I15;2;1). So if someone was arleady attached to task number one - there will be "2".

Now i would like to modify the formula from N3:N8 that would exclude every single cell that contains "2" (so the same person won't be attache in new week).
